There are groups similar to AA and NA--  groups like SA, or SLA (sex and love addicts), for people with compulsive sexual behaviors and relationship addictions. Most major cities have chapters and meetings, and you can likely find their literature for sale on the web by searching for sex addiction or sex and love addiction.

The symptoms that you describe are common for people with addictive sexual behaviors.  People get to a point where they can only respond sexually to tightly controlled situations,  where true intimacy is not an issue, and they feel like they have control.  

There are also residential treatment programs;  the one at The Meadows in Arizona is one of the more well-known programs.
